Emily is an ambitious worker whose performance has suffered since she joined her new company. Emily feels that even though she enjoys the work, feels safe, and enjoys the office's facilities, such as the cafeteria and the pool table, she has not been able to reach out to the others in the office. She has no friends and feels isolated. According to Maslow's hierarchy of needs, which of Emily's needs is most likely not being satisfied at her new job? A. Existence needs B. Belongingness needs Correct: The Correct Answer is: B. According to Maslow's hierarchy of needs, Emily's belongingness needs are most likely not being satisfied. Belongingness needs refer to the need for social interaction, friendship, affection, and love. C. Safety needs D. Physiological needs 2. Sameer perceives underpayment equity when he compares his outcome-input ratio to Lamar's. Sameer believes that he is putting in more effort and should therefore receive a larger hike in salary. To avoid this lack of equity, Sameer decides that he need not compare his outcome-input ratio to Lamar's; instead he should compare it to Adrian's. According to the equity theory of motivation, how is Sameer restoring equity? A. By changing his inputs or outputs Correct: The Correct Answer is: C. Sameer is changing his referent to restore equity. A referent is a person chosen by an individual for the purpose of comparing his or her outcome-input ratio. B. By changing his referent's input or outputs C. By changing his referent D.
